Welcome to Chalkline, our school timetable solver at Merrowfield Systems!

Quick orientation for the security review: the solver runs in an isolated worker pool, and student data is pseudonymized before scheduling begins. Config changes go through signed bundles only. To inspect the signing vault in the staging environment, you'll need the recovery passphrase, which is included below.

vault phrase of bagaf-kajeg = jorath-feniel-briir-siliel-ralix

**14:22** — Gateway Ostler began shedding internal traffic after the tenant quota table went stale. Rate limiter defaulted to the strictest tier, rejecting 60% of requests from the Pinfold batch jobs. Mitigated by forcing a quota refresh. Root cause traced to the deploy carrying this identifier.

pipeline stamp: htk3_69f

## Authentication

Prunebot authenticates to the internal Branchvault API before deleting stale branches. Tokens are scoped to delete-only; it cannot push or merge. Rotate quarterly via the ops pipeline. Reviewers: confirm the scope claim in the config matches delete-only before approving. The key Prunebot presents to Branchvault is below.

gateway credential: kto2_aa